Pedestrian injured in Brentwood crash

A pedestrian was seriously injured Thursday night in a Brentwood motor vehicle crash. Authorities say 45 year old Juan Martinez-Umana was walking on Fifth Avenue near Third Avenue around 9pm, when he was struck by an eastbound vehicle.  Police say the vehicle was a 2011 Honda Pilot driven by Dinorah Pantaleon.  The vehicle was impounded for a safety check.  The pedestrian was transported to Southside Hospital in Bay Shore for treatment of serious injuries.  Anyone with information on this crash is asked to call the Third Squad at 631-854-8352
